Chelsea hero Joe Cole has blamed four PSG players for their team’s UEFA Champions League round of 16 first-leg 1-0 loss to Bayern Munich on Tuesday night.
Bayern Munich defeated PSG 1-0 in Paris, thanks to a goal from Kingsley Coman.
Cole blamed PSG goalkeeper Gianluigi Donnarumma for not being able to save Coman’s strike, believing the former AC Milan keeper was to blame for the goal.
Former England international also believed PSG’s back-line, Sergio Ramos, Presnel Kimpembe, and Nuno Mendes, was partially to blame, adding: “[Sergio] Ramos was dragged out and [Presnel] Kimpembe was out of position.”
“You talk about the art of defending, it seems to have gone out of the game.”
“[Nuno] Mendes needs to be higher. At left-back, I worry about him, seeing that goal, it looks like he loses concentration.”
